Output ab66a8967d8dde18e7e7f4b2a8623c34032115e0eecd24582c6c4c37d6e05e13:1

value
34133744
script pubkey
OP_0 OP_PUSHBYTES_20 278abba9dae3ecb2a49aa7692739f5c1a8611346
address
ltc1qy79th2w6u0kt9fy65a5jww04cx5xzy6xwhatdq
transaction
ab66a8967d8dde18e7e7f4b2a8623c34032115e0eecd24582c6c4c37d6e05e13
spent
true